Your Gut Is Not Seperate From Your Mood
Many women are surprised when I explain that digestive symptoms can influence emotional symptoms.
But the gut is not simply a tube that processes food.
It is an immune organ.
A microbial ecosystem.
A communication hub.
A hormone-processing system.
A sensory interface between the outside world and the inner body.
The gut communicates with the brain through the vagus nerve, immune signalling, microbial metabolites, inflammatory pathways and neurotransmitter-related compounds.
This is why changes in gut health can sometimes show up as changes in mood, clarity, resilience or anxiety.
A woman may say, “I feel emotionally off.”
But sometimes the deeper picture includes bloating, constipation, histamine reactivity, poor nutrient absorption, inflammation or microbial imbalance.
The composition of the microbiome matters because different microbes produce different metabolites. Some support short-chain fatty acid production, gut lining integrity and immune balance, while others may contribute to inflammatory signalling when the terrain becomes disrupted.

Why Midlife Changes the Gut Terrain
Perimenopause is a hormonal transition, but it is also a gut transition.
Oestrogen influences gut motility, the microbiome, inflammation and the integrity of the gut lining. As oestrogen fluctuates, some women notice that their digestion becomes less predictable.
Foods that once felt fine suddenly feel heavy.
Alcohol creates more symptoms.
Histamine reactions become stronger.
Constipation appears.
Bloating becomes more persistent.
This is not random.
Hormonal shifts can alter how the gut moves, how the immune system responds and how efficiently the body metabolises and clears hormones.

The Estrobolome: Where Gut Health Meets Hormone Metabolism
One of the most important bridges between gut health and hormones is the oestrobolome.
The oestrobolome refers to the collection of gut bacteria involved in metabolising and recycling oestrogen.
When the gut microbiome is balanced, oestrogen metabolism and elimination tend to function more smoothly. But when the gut terrain becomes disrupted, oestrogen recycling may become less efficient or more excessive, depending on the microbial pattern.
This matters because many women in perimenopause experience symptoms that feel like hormone chaos: breast tenderness, heavy periods, mood swings, bloating, irritability or histamine sensitivity.
Sometimes the issue is not simply how much oestrogen is being produced.
It is also how well the body is processing and clearing it.
This is why gut health is never separate from hormone health.
Bile Flow, Gallbladder Sludge and Hormonal Change
There is another piece of the gut-hormone picture that is often missed: bile.
Bile is produced by the liver and stored in the gallbladder. It helps digest fats, absorb fat-soluble nutrients and support the elimination of used hormones and toxins through the bowel. When bile flow becomes sluggish, digestion often feels heavier. Women may notice bloating after fatty meals, nausea, pale or floating stools, constipation, a sense of fullness or discomfort under the right rib cage.
In midlife, hormonal changes can also influence this picture. Oestrogen can affect cholesterol concentration in bile, while progesterone may slow gallbladder motility. Together, this can contribute to thicker, more stagnant bile and, in some women, gallbladder sludge or gallstones.
This matters because sluggish bile is not only a digestive issue. It can affect hormone clearance, gut motility, microbial balance and how efficiently the body moves waste out. When bile is not flowing well, the whole digestive terrain can feel slower, heavier and more reactive.

Constipation, Clearance and Emotional Load
Constipation is often dismissed as a minor digestive issue.
But in a root-cause picture, it matters.
If bowel movements are slow, used hormones, bile metabolites and inflammatory compounds may remain in the gut longer than ideal. This can influence reabsorption and contribute to a feeling of heaviness, stagnation or bloating.

Histamine, Gut Reactivity and Anxiety
Histamine is another important piece.
The gut contains many immune cells, including mast cells. These cells can release histamine and other inflammatory mediators when the system becomes reactive.
In midlife, some women notice they become more sensitive to wine, fermented foods, leftovers, stress, heat or certain phases of the cycle.
This can show up as flushing, headaches, bloating, itching, palpitations, anxiety or poor sleep.
That anxiety may not be purely psychological.
It may be part immune, part hormonal, part nervous system.

The Microbiome, Fibre and Inflammation
The gut microbiome helps regulate inflammation.
When microbial diversity is reduced or the gut lining is irritated, inflammatory signalling may increase. This can influence the brain, the immune system and the way the nervous system responds to stress.
One of the most powerful ways to support this ecosystem is through fibre.
Fibre is not simply “roughage”. It is food for beneficial gut bacteria. When gut microbes ferment certain fibres, they produce short-chain fatty acids, often called SCFAs, such as butyrate, acetate and propionate.
These compounds help nourish the cells lining the colon, support gut barrier integrity, influence inflammation and communicate with the immune system. Butyrate in particular is often discussed because of its role in supporting the gut lining and regulating inflammatory signalling.
This is why a diverse, colourful, fibre-rich diet can be so important in midlife. It is not only about bowel movements. It is about feeding the microbial community that helps regulate inflammation, hormone metabolism and the gut-brain conversation.

Intestinal Permeability, Inflammation and the “Leaky Brain” Conversation
When the gut lining becomes more permeable, sometimes referred to as “leaky gut”, substances that should remain contained within the gut may interact more strongly with the immune system. This can contribute to inflammatory signalling, which may then influence how the brain and nervous system respond.
Some researchers also discuss the concept of increased blood-brain barrier permeability, sometimes called “leaky brain”. This does not mean the gut and brain are literally leaking in a simplistic way. It refers to the idea that inflammation and immune activation may affect the protective barriers that normally help regulate what enters both the gut lining and the brain environment. This is an evolving area of research, and it should not be used to self-diagnose. I use these concepts clinically as part of a wider discussion about inflammation, immune signalling and nervous system sensitivity.
For women in midlife, this matters because inflammation, gut imbalance, stress physiology and hormonal fluctuation can all interact.
A woman may experience this as brain fog, low mood, anxiety, fatigue, food reactivity or feeling less resilient than before.

The Gut Needs Safety Too
Digestion is not only biochemical.
It is also neurological.
The gut works best when the body feels safe enough to digest. If a woman is eating in a rush, working through lunch, scrolling stressful messages, drinking coffee instead of eating, or living in a constant state of alert, digestion often suffers.
The body cannot prioritise deep digestion when it believes it is in survival mode.
This is where the vagus nerve becomes important. It helps coordinate the parasympathetic state needed for digestion, repair and emotional regulation.
This is why calming the nervous system before meals is not “soft advice”.
It is physiology.

Frequently Asked Questions
Can gut health affect mood in perimenopause?
Yes. The gut communicates with the brain through the nervous system, immune pathways, microbial metabolites and inflammatory signalling, all of which can influence mood and resilience.
What is the gut-brain-hormone axis?
It describes the interaction between gut health, brain function, immune signalling, hormone metabolism and nervous system regulation.
Can poor gut health affect oestrogen?
Yes. Gut bacteria involved in the oestrobolome help metabolise and recycle oestrogen, which can influence hormone balance.
Can histamine cause anxiety?
Histamine and mast cell activation can contribute to symptoms such as palpitations, flushing, poor sleep and anxiety-like sensations in some women.
Can bile flow affect hormones?
Yes. Bile supports fat digestion, nutrient absorption and the elimination of used hormones through the bowel. Sluggish bile flow may contribute to slower digestion, constipation and altered hormone clearance.
Does stress affect digestion?
Yes. Chronic stress can reduce digestive function, alter motility and affect the gut-brain connection.
